New York: G. Schirmer, 1937. Hardcover. Very Good. The uncommon 1937 signed/limited. ONE OF FIFTY SPECIAL COPIES SIGNED BY ARNOLD SCHOENBERG at the limitation. A solid copy to boot of this impressive tribute to Schoengerg, with "a Foreword by Leopold Stokowski, affirmations by Arnold Schoenberg, a bibliography of Schoenberg works, portraits by Edward Weston and George Gershwin, a self-portrait by Arnold Schoenberg, candid camera photographs by Otto Rothschild and two ink drawings by Carlos Dyer". Additionally, articles by Roger Sessions, Franz Werfel, Otto Klemperer, Nicholas Slonimsky, Merle Armitage, etc. Solid and VG- in its special dark-leatherette, with bright gilt-design to the front panel and spine. Minor cracking and wear along the outer hinges (which still hold very firmly) and light soiling to the panels. Pronounced foxing at the endsheets and pastedowns but, happily, none of it affects the text or the plates. Publisher's chipped, thick mylar dustjacket as well. Octavo, edited --and designed-- by the formidable Merle Armitage. A truly scarce Arnold Schoenberg item.
